Novi Sad is the cultural capital of the Serbia’s province – Vojvodina,
and it is characterized by its neoclassical style in architecture.
Competition was to design a typical old market and square next to it,
on the location inside the city’s center. Instead of closed building
for a market, we offered a large canopy that protects and defines the
space of the market, but also serves as an extension of the square and
thus represents a stage for the city’s events.
